Sisters Cafe
Going back to 2022, Sisters Cafe has 10 inspections in the public record. The most recent visit was on Feb 5, 2026. Diners can read the low risk label as a sign that recent inspections have gone well.
Violation counts have held steady across recent visits, averaging around two violations each.
When inspectors have written things up, “accumulation of black/green mold-like substance” has been the most frequent reason, cited four times.
The city-wide average for Panama City sits at 83, putting Sisters Cafe on the better side of that line. The file should reassure diners considering a visit.
